Part 4Devolution of policing and justice etc.

20Provision for entrenching enactments

After section 86A of the 1998 Act insert—

86BProvision for entrenching enactments

(1)Her Majesty may by Order in Council make provision amending section 7 so as to provide for—

(a)enactments to become entrenched; or

(b)enactments that are entrenched by virtue of an Order under paragraph (a) to cease to be entrenched.

(2)For the purposes of this section an enactment is entrenched if section 7 prevents it from being modified by an Act of the Assembly or subordinate legislation made, confirmed or approved by a Minister or Northern Ireland department.

(3)No recommendation shall be made to Her Majesty to make an Order under this section unless a draft of it has been laid before and approved by resolution of each House of Parliament.
